fragmento

/fɾaɡˈmento/

noun, masculine/fɾaɡˈmento/plural: fragmentos

fragment; clip (a frame containing a number of bullets which is intended to be inserted into the magazine of a firearm to allow for rapid reloading.)

Synonyms: clip

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*bʰreg- Proto-Indo-European *-né- Latin frangō Proto-Indo-European *-mn̥ Proto-Indo-European *-mn̥tom Proto-Italic *-mentom Latin -mentum Latin fragmentumlbor. Spanish fragmento Learned borrowing from Latin fragmentum.
